Traditional American Designs
Known as American Traditional, this style is characterized by bold black outlines and a restricted color palette, typically featuring primary colors. Common motifs include roses, anchors, eagles, and skulls. These ear tattoos for males are famous for their ability to age well, looking fantastic for decades.
Minimalist and Geometric Tattoos
For those who prefer a more subtle look, minimalist tattoos are an excellent choice. They emphasize fine lines, simple shapes, and uncluttered composition. Geometric tattoos fall into this category, using symmetrical patterns like circles, triangles, and mandalas to create appealing ear tattoos for males. These are ideal for a simple yet elegant piece of art.
Artistic Ink Wash Styles
A more contemporary trend, watercolor tattoos replicate the look of a painting. They feature soft color blending, splatters, and a an absence of solid black outlines. This technique creates a beautifully free-flowing effect on the skin. This style is wonderful for artistic and unique ear tattoos for males.
